Andhra Pradesh is set to host a match of the ICC Women’s Cricket World Cup 2025 after a 28-year hiatus. Vishakhapatnam’s Dr YSR ACA–VDCA Stadium is among four Indian venues selected, with the tournament running from 30 September to 2 November across India and Sri Lanka. The stadium will welcome at least one Group‑stage fixture, marking a revival of international women’s cricket in the state since 1997. This return to the global stage is expected to boost local infrastructure and fan engagement, further cementing Visakhapatnam’s status as a significant cricketing hub. (PC: The Hindu)
